Курс Python → Оформление текста в консоли с TermColor
В Python существует библиотека TermColor, которая позволяет создавать красивое оформление текста в консоли. Это особенно полезно, когда нужно выделить определенные части текста или сообщений для улучшения читаемости и привлечения внимания пользователя. Библиотека TermColor предоставляет различные стили и цвета для текста, что позволяет создавать креативный и информативный вывод в консоли.
Для использования библиотеки TermColor вам необходимо сначала установить ее с помощью pip. Для этого выполните команду pip install termcolor в вашем терминале. После установки вы можете импортировать модуль TermColor в свой скрипт с помощью import termcolor.
Пример использования библиотеки TermColor:
import termcolor
print(termcolor.colored('Привет, мир!', 'red', attrs=['bold']))
В данном примере мы использовали функцию colored из модуля TermColor для вывода текста «Привет, мир!» красным цветом и с жирным шрифтом. Вы также можете использовать другие цвета и стили, такие как зеленый, синий, желтый, и т.д., а также комбинировать их для создания разнообразных эффектов.
Используя библиотеку TermColor, вы можете легко улучшить визуальное оформление вашего вывода в консоли, делая его более привлекательным и информативным для пользователя. Это особенно полезно при создании скриптов, где важно передать определенные сообщения или выделить ключевую информацию. Не стесняйтесь экспериментировать с различными стилями и цветами, чтобы создать уникальный и запоминающийся вывод.
Другие уроки курса "Python"
- Расчет времени выполнения программы
- Удаление элементов по срезу
- Работа с SQLite в Python
- Создание виртуальной среды
- Параллельные вычисления в Python
- Управление контекстом выполнения
- List Comprehension Tutorial
- Пропуск строк в файле с itertools
- Переопределение метода len
- Форматирование строк в Python
- Lambda-функция в Python: использование с map() и sum()
- Анонимные функции в Python
- Извлечение новостей с newspaper3k
- Расчет времени выполнения кода
- JSON-esque в Python
- Повторение элементов в Python
- Создание комплексных чисел
- Абстракции словарей и множеств в Python
- Удаление файлов и папок в Python
- PrettyTable: создание таблицы
- Встроенные функции Python
- Конвертация коллекций в Python.
- Метод rpow в Python
- Модуль itertools: комбинации и перестановки
- Добавление элемента в список.
- Работа со строками в Python.
- Подсказки типов в Python
- Функция all() в Python
- Удаление символа из строки
- Логирование в Python
- Управление сессиями в Python
- Роль object и type в Python
- Объединение списков в Python
- Возвращение нескольких значений
- Передача словаря через **kwargs
- Python groupby() из itertools: работа с повторяющимися элементами
- f-строки в формате строк
- Метод remove() для удаления элемента из списка
- Метод rxor для операции побитового исключающего «или»
- Проверка версии Python
- Хэш-функции и метод цепочек
- Названия столбцов в Python таблицах
- Магические методы в Python
- Python reversed() vs срез[::-1]
- Синтаксис переменных цикла в Python















